Q: What questions do you ask prospective clients?
A: When working with prospective clients, I like to ask a few key questions to make sure I fully understand their vision and needs: What’s the overall vibe or mood you’re aiming for in this track? – This helps me understand the emotional tone and how I can contribute with the right style of guitar playing. Are there any specific guitar sounds or techniques you’d like to incorporate? – Whether it’s a particular tone, technique, or even a specific artist’s style you want to emulate, this ensures I’m on the right track. Do you have any references or inspirations for the song? – This allows me to align my work with the reference material you love or find the right influences for your sound. What are your expectations for the guitar arrangement? – Understanding whether you want a lead part, rhythm, subtle layers, or something else helps me approach the arrangement properly. What’s the timeline for this project? – Knowing the deadline helps me prioritize and make sure I deliver on time without sacrificing quality. Is there any additional feedback or revisions you’d like during the process? – Open communication is key, so I like to know if you’d prefer to have check-ins or a more hands-off approach.

Q: What's your typical work process?
A: My typical work process starts with understanding the artist's vision and the specific sound they are looking for. I like to have a conversation or exchange messages to get a feel for the style and mood of the project. Once I have a clear idea of what’s needed, I begin recording guitar parts tailored to the track—whether it’s electric, acoustic, or a blend of both. If it's a complex piece, I might start with basic demos to ensure we’re on the right track. I’ll then refine the parts, focusing on details like tone, dynamics, and feel to match the vibe of the song. After I finish recording, I provide high-quality stems or tracks, and I’m always open to feedback or revisions to make sure the guitar parts fit perfectly with the rest of the project. I strive to deliver the final tracks on time, always keeping communication open throughout the process.
